The issue with the tree is the same as the painter had that I initially followed (tutorial) until I found the right photo of the temple: it's acrylics. He did it with oils, does the base with acrylics and finishes with oils over it. I don't do that.
Getting the highlights and shadows to blend beautifully is much easier with oils than acrylics. And when the surface is somewhat larger I always manage, but now I have to be careful not to go over the openings in between the trunk/roots.
Meaning I have to use small size brushes which doesn't help with blending.
For some reason I lost too much of these open spaces in between the roots as it is. I think I will correct that as it will also help make the shape of the tree look better. To me it looks somewhat odd now.

Feels contra-intuitive: the roots have to be massive, yet I have to make them thinner.
